R410 SWG is a 1997 Ford Escort Van in White with a 1,753c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 5 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 1997 Ford Escort Van models, the average MOT pass rate is 57.4% with a typical mileage of 45,858 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Escort Van fails its MOT is se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 8,850 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R410 SWG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Escort Van typ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 29 years old, this Ford Escort Van is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
